In the best-case scenario, you are the developer of the VR experience, and you want to shoot a 360° video of your own game for promotional purposes. If you are a Unity developer like me, you can use the awesome Unity Recorder package to shoot videos of your experience, both 2D videos and 360videos.

This new standard evolves the previous H265 compression format for videos, reducing data requirement up to 50% while providing visually the same quality. The standard will prove especially efficient for 4K and 8K video and it works with high dynamic range video and omnidirectional 360° video. More info.
